Comparitive Study on the Effect of Serum and Plasma on Glucose and Cholesterol Estimation

Abstract: Objective is to study if there is any clinically signiûcant difference between EDTA plasma and serum for glucose and cholesterol estimation. A general problem faced by the clinical laboratories is the integrity of uncentrifuged specimens for chemical analyses.
